Definitions:

Miliaria

A skin condition characterized by small, raised bumps and possibly itchiness due to blocked sweat ducts.

Prickly Heat

A skin rash caused by blocked sweat ducts and trapped sweat beneath the skin, often occurring in hot, humid conditions.

Sweat Test

A diagnostic test primarily used to identify cystic fibrosis, measuring the amount of chloride in sweat.

Chloride

A negatively charged ion (Cl-) that is an essential electrolyte in the body, involved in maintaining fluid balance and blood pressure.
